A body projected vertically from the earth reaches a height equal to earth's radius before returning to the earth. The power exerted by the gravitational force is greatest
A
at the highest position of the body
B
at the instant just before the body hits the earth.
C
it remains constant all through.
D
at the instant just after the body is projected.

The moment of inertia of a thin uniform rod of mass M and length L about an axis passing through its midpoint and perpendicular to its length is $$I$$0. Its moment of inertia about an axis passing through one of its ends and perpendicular to its length is
A
$${I_0} + M{L^2}/2$$
B
$${I_0} + M{L^2}/4$$
C
$${I_0} + 2M{L^2}$$
D
$${I_0} + M{L^2}$$
